Understanding Physical AI
Physical AI refers to the integration of artificial intelligence into physical systems, enabling machines to perform tasks with a level of autonomy and efficiency previously unattainable. This domain of AI is being actively developed by companies like NVIDIA, which are creating models to support its growth.
Impact on Smart Manufacturing
The smart manufacturing sector is directly impacted by the advancements in Physical AI. By incorporating these technologies, manufacturers can optimize processes, improve operational efficiency, and ultimately enhance productivity. The report underscores the potential for AI to streamline operations, reduce costs, and increase competitiveness in the market.

Challenges and Opportunities
While the opportunities presented by Physical AI are significant, there are also challenges to consider. One major threat is the obsolescence of traditional manufacturing methods. Companies that fail to adopt AI technologies risk losing market share to more agile competitors who embrace these innovations.
